【瘋狂實戰(zhàn)一】
A: Someone came to see you last night.(昨天晚上有人來看你。)
B: Last night? What does he look like?
(昨晚?他長什么樣子?)
A: He’s rather tall with blonde hair and has blue eyes.
(他高個子,一頭金發(fā),還有一雙藍眼睛。)
【瘋狂實戰(zhàn)二】
A: What’s the weather in your hometown like?
(你家鄉(xiāng)的天氣怎么樣?)
B: We’ve got a sandy spring, hot summer, golden fall and cold winter.
(我們那里春天風(fēng)沙跑,夏天熱難熬,秋天賽金寶,冬天北風(fēng)嚎。)
A: Your hometown must be Beijing!
(你家鄉(xiāng)肯定是北京。)
【現(xiàn)場演繹】
News reports rely on description. News writers and reporters are trained to answer the “Big Five” or “Five W” questions with as much description as possible. When reporting you answer the questions; when interviewing, you ask the following: Who, What, When, Where, Why.
新聞報導(dǎo)就是依靠描述。新聞撰稿人和記者都是用盡可能多的描述去回答“五大”或者“五個W”問題的專家。報導(dǎo)時,需要回答問題;采訪時,需要問問題,這“五大”問題就是:何人、何事、何時、何地、何因。
A TV news reporter is interviewing someone who has just saved a little boy at the beach.
一位電視新聞記者正在沙灘上采訪剛剛救起一個落水小男孩的英雄。
A: What happened and when did it happen?
(發(fā)生了什么事?什么時候發(fā)生的?)
B: Well, I was lying on the beach listening to the radio this afternoon, when suddenly I heard someone shouting for help.
(唔,今天下午我躺在沙灘上聽收音機,突然間我聽到有人喊救命。)
A: So what did you do?
(接著你做了什么?)
B: I jumped up. Looked out toward the ocean, and saw a little boy waving his arms in the air.
(我跳了起來,向大海望去,看到一個小男孩的手臂在空中揮舞。)
A: What did you do next?
(你接下來是怎么做的?)
B: I took off my shirt and my watch and jumped into the water.
(我脫掉上衣,解下手表,跳進水里。)
A: And THEN what did you do?
(然后你又怎么做呢?)
B: I swam out to the little boy, held him so his head stayed above water, and brought him back to shore.
(我向那小男孩游過去,抱住他,把他的頭抬出水面,然后帶他返回岸邊。)
A: That sounds like it was really an experience!
(聽起來像是一次不同尋常的經(jīng)歷。)
B: It sure was!
(確實是!)
